dc.description.abstract | Stage I has great potential for saving water and increasing physical WP by 44-178% by adoption of packages that maximize WP For stage I, cluster bean-mustard crop rotation is most economically water productive cropping system Stage II has even greater potential for saving water and increasing physical WP by 100-290% by adoption of packages that maximize WP Since, energy and water storage are expensive, stage II farmers should adopt crop rotations that give highest economic WP. Groundnut-isabgol rotation was found to be best option for farmers in stage II. | en_US |
